The Xbox One will launch in China on Sep. 29, Microsoft said today. That’s something of a surprise after the company announced on Friday that the console had been delayed from its original Sep. 22 date and would launch “by the end of this year.” The console will launch with 10 games, with more than 70 more awaiting government approval.
